Peter a Stuart Plumbing Ltd
BackEstablished in 2003, Peter a Stuart Plumbing Ltd has been a fixture on Aberlour's High Street for over two decades, offering a range of plumbing and heating solutions. The company operates from a physical address at 69 High St, Aberlour AB38 9QB, providing a sense of stability and local presence. They maintain standard business hours, operating from 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M, Monday to Friday, which is convenient for planned projects and non-urgent repairs.

Scope of Plumbing Services
The company's official classification as a provider of "Plumbing, heat and air-conditioning installation" is supported by various online directories. This indicates they are more than just a simple repair service. Their offered expertise appears to cover a broad spectrum of needs, which is a major advantage for customers looking for a single contractor for complex jobs.
Key services identified include:
- General Plumbing: This covers fundamental tasks such as leak detection, pipe repairs, and fixture installation.
- Heating and Central Heating: They are listed as providing services for central heating installation, maintenance, and general heating system work. This suggests they are equipped to handle significant projects like full system fits and upgrades.
- Bathroom Fitting: One source specifically highlights them as a "trusted bathroom fitter," indicating specialism in bathroom renovations and installations within a 20-mile radius of Aberlour.
- Drainage Services: The inclusion of drainage in their service list points to capabilities in handling blocked drains and related sewage system issues.
Areas for Customer Consideration
While the positives are clear, there are several aspects potential clients should be aware of. The most pressing is the lack of readily available information regarding their out-of-hours availability. There is no mention of a 24-hour emergency plumber service. For a household facing a burst pipe on a Saturday or a boiler failure late on a weekday evening, this lack of clarity could be a decisive factor. Customers with urgent needs outside of the standard 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M weekday hours would need to contact them directly to ascertain if any emergency support is offered.
Furthermore, for any work involving gas appliances, such as boiler repair or the installation of gas heating systems, it is legally required for the engineer to be on the Gas Safe Register. Information about Peter a Stuart Plumbing Ltd's Gas Safe registration is not prominently displayed across their online listings. While many established firms hold this essential certification, its absence in their promotional information is a critical omission. It is imperative that any customer seeking gas-related work directly asks for and verifies the company's Gas Safe credentials before commissioning any project.
